Job Overview:
Lead an end-to-end, data-driven collections, recovery, and legal strategy across secured products, managing delinquency to NPA lifecycle, repossession, stakeholder coordination, and feedback into credit underwriting.
Key Roles & Responsibilities:
- Lead the design and execution of end-to-end collections strategies across LAP Mass & Micro, Two-Wheeler, and Commercial Vehicle portfolios, covering early, mid, and hard delinquency buckets.
- Define customer treatment strategies, contact intensity frameworks, and resolution pathways to reduce roll rates and improve recovery effectiveness.
- Partner with Analytics teams to conceptualize and deploy predictive models such as prioritization, early payer identification, repossession optimization, and settlement models to drive data-led decision-making.
- Enhance field collections productivity through intelligent queue allocation, segmentation, and analytics-driven intervention strategies.
- Drive automation and digitization of MIS, dashboards, and reporting frameworks, leveraging technology to improve operational efficiency, governance, and visibility.
- Collaborate with Business, Operations, Risk, and Analytics teams to continuously optimize collection processes and deliver portfolio performance improvements.
- Ensure adherence to all regulatory, legal, and compliance requirements related to secured collections while driving best-in-class recovery and customer resolution practices.
Experience Required:
- CA/MBA
- Min 10+ years of experience in collections with at least 4 years of experience in Secured collection
- At least 5-7 years of dedicated experience in secured lending collections, with demonstrable expertise in one or more of: CV, CE, LAP Mass, Micro LAP
- Exposure to NPA management, SARFAESI enforcement, and legal collections is essential.
